  4. Hi, Calanthee! In the Rich Text Editor, you should be able to go all the way down to the very bottom (the blank part) and backspace away all those extra lines. I have no idea why the RTE does that, but I know if I use the Paste from Word option (even for OpenOffice or LibreOffice), it keeps my formatting a little better. Except for centering. I have no idea why, but I have to edit to make things centered again. Do you copy and paste into the text box? That's usually the best way, I've found. And I use either Word or LibreOffice, depending on my mood. (And I'm really enjoying the new story, too!)

  14. We do have a thread for story adoption, and the process is stepped out as to how we need to proceed. And as long as the series is here on AFF, you can promote it here using the format for a story promotion. I'm going to assume that by various media, you mean various fandoms as well, so each story would have to be published in that fandom's appropriate subdomain, or category within a subdomain. That would mean each story would have a unique url, so you'd need to make a promo post for each story, but you can reference the larger series, and perhaps suggest readers check out your profile to see the stories you've written.
  15. Willow is correct about placement, so depending on the primary fandom setting, we'd determine the appropriate archive. We don't have specific pairing subcategories for Inuyasha or for Naruto under the Crossovers category of those subdomains, and YuYu does not have category divisions at all. However, crossovers for YuYu can be placed in the general subdomain. We're always happy to have new members posting here, so welcome!
